Key Features of Snipaste

Snipaste sets itself apart from the competition with a myriad of features that cater to both casual users and professionals alike. Here are some of the key functionalities:

  • Smart UI Element Detection: Snipaste intelligently recognizes UI elements on your screen, enabling pixel-perfect captures without manual adjustments.
  • Innovative Pasting to Screen Feature: Users can paste screenshots directly onto their screen, allowing for immersive reference without obstructing their workflow.
  • Comprehensive Annotation Toolkit: The tool comes equipped with various annotation tools like rectangles, arrows, text boxes, and pixelation options, enhancing information clarity.
  • Offline OCR Text Recognition: Snipaste’s Optical Character Recognition (OCR) technology allows users to extract text from images, all while ensuring privacy and data security.
  • Multi-screen and HiDPI Support: The software adapts seamlessly to multiple displays, ensuring no detail is missed across different screen resolutions.
  • Precise Color Picker: Perfect for designers, this feature allows quick retrieval of color values in RGB and HSV formats.

Cross-Platform Compatibility and User Experience

Another significant advantage of Snipaste is its cross-platform functionality. The tool is available for Windows, macOS, and Linux, ensuring that users can access its powerful features regardless of their operating system. This versatility allows teams to collaborate effectively across different platforms and devices, creating a seamless user experience.

How to Download and Install Snipaste

Getting started with Snipaste is a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help first-time users get the app installed on their systems:

Step-by-Step Guide for Different Operating Systems

To download and install Snipaste:

  1. Visit the official Snipaste website.
  2. Select your operating system (Windows, macOS, or Linux) and click on the download link.
  3. Once the setup file is downloaded, run the installer and follow the on-screen instructions.
  4. After installation, launch Snipaste and customize your settings according to your preferences.

What are the main features of Snipaste?

Snipaste offers a comprehensive set of features, including smart UI detection, advanced annotation tools, offline OCR capabilities, multi-platform support, and a color picker tool. These features work together to provide users with a streamlined and productive screenshot experience.

How to customize shortcut keys in Snipaste?

To customize shortcut keys in Snipaste, access the settings menu and navigate to the shortcuts section. Here, you can assign key combinations to various functions, tailoring the software to your workflow needs.

Is Snipaste available on mobile devices?

Currently, Snipaste is primarily available for desktop platforms, with plans for mobile compatibility in the future. Users can stay updated on developments through the official website.

How does offline OCR work in Snipaste?

Snipaste’s offline OCR uses lightweight AI models to recognize text within images without the need for internet connectivity. This ensures user privacy while providing a fast and efficient text extraction process.
